Dr. Cara McDermott, D.O., helps children, teens, adults, and seniors across South Carolina find stability, clarity, and renewed functioning through thoughtful psychiatric care. As a prescriber at LifeStance Health, she provides medication management for conditions such as ADHD, anxiety, and depression, while also supporting individuals navigating substance use with evidence-based medication treatment. Dr. McDermott partners closely with patients to create practical, personalized plans that respect each person’s goals, strengths, and life circumstances. She is especially passionate about supporting individuals who are recently discharged from a psychiatric hospital, helping them transition safely back into daily life with close follow-up, symptom monitoring, and coordinated care. Dr. McDermott understands how vulnerable this period can be and prioritizes continuity, clear communication, and compassionate guidance to reduce relapse risk and promote long-term recovery. Dr. McDermott treats children and adolescents, teens, young adults, adults, and older adults. Her clinical experience also includes working with members of the LGBTQ+ community, military and veteran populations, and individuals involved in adoption or foster care. In addition to her primary specialties, she offers care for a wide range of additional mental health concerns, tailoring medication strategies to each stage of life and level of complexity. Her osteopathic training supports a whole-person approach that considers both mental and physical health when developing treatment plans.
